Dr Roger Peel

Senior Visiting Fellow

Qualifications: BSc, PhD, MBCS

Email:

Further information

Research Interests

Embedded computer systems often contain concurrency. My research is addressing the hardware/software codesign of such systems using a communicating process model and a common design language for both components.

In particular, I am investigating the compilation, optimisation and subsequent execution of the Occam programming language directly on Field-Programmable Gate Arrays. This is proving to be a good fast-prototyping tool for FPGA designs.

We are also exploiting fast serial links to provide communication between FPGAs and conventional processors, as well as USB for slower synchronised FPGA interfaces.